Exposure to intense illumination light is an unavoidable consequence of fluorescence microscopy, and poses a risk to the health of the sample in every livecell fluorescence microscopy experiment. Plant tissues must be preserved by dehydration for observation in an electron microscope because the coating system and the microscopes operate under high vacuum and most specimens cannot withstand water removal by the vacuum system without distortion holloway and baker. Laser capture microdissection lcm is a technique by which individual cells can be harvested from tissue sections while they are viewed under the microscope, by tacking selected cells to an adhesive film with a laser beam. Sted microscopy is one of several types of super resolution microscopy techniques that have recently been developed to bypass the diffraction limit of light microscopy to increase resolution.
